When you meditate, focusing on the pineal gland, it's believed to stimulate this organ, helping to release melatonin, the hormone that puts us to sleep at night,. The benefits of this meditation can include improved sleep patterns, reduced stress and anxiety levels, and heightened spiritual awareness. read less

Why do my legs go numb when meditating?
Due to the pressure it give your body while sitting for so long in one posture hence the blood flow get slow and you feel the numbness. To avoid it sit in a cofurtable position.
